Intro:
Crystal Palace manager Tony Pulis said on Thursday that clubs had to help officials deal with simulation ahead of their English Premier League game against Southampton on Saturday.
Script:
SOUNDBITE: (English) Tony Pulis, Crystal Palace manager (Q: With the games against Manchester City, Liverpool and Chelsea and then you've got Aston Villa and Southampton, are they the two games you need to target to get three points from?)
"No, like I say, we know how tough this run is for us. You know we've got as tough as anybody in the bottom ten, but we'll get our heads down and work as hard as we can. You know there's what is it - ten, eleven teams - that are fighting for their lives and we're ahead of the game in lots of respects because we're still in with a chance and nobody gave us that chance a long time ago, or not a long time ago, quite a short time ago."
